National Award-winning Bollywood actress Kangana Ranaut is all set to make her Hollywood debut in the upcoming horror drama ‘Blessed Be The Evil’.
The actress will take on the lead role in the film, alongside ‘Teen Wolf’ star Tyler Posey and Scarlett Rose Stallone, as reported by Variety.
The film centers around a Christian couple who, after experiencing a tragic miscarriage, relocate to an abandoned farm with a mysterious past. As they attempt to heal and rebuild their lives, they find their love and faith increasingly tested by a sinister presence lurking on the property.
Blessed Be The Evil is being produced by Lions Movies and will begin production this summer in New York. The choice of location was made to sidestep any potential issues related to the recently imposed Trump industry tariffs. The film will be directed by Anurag Rudra, known for Tailing Pond, who co-wrote the screenplay with Gatha Tiwary, president and founder of Lions Movies.
Rudra shared his excitement about the project, saying, "Having grown up in rural India, I was deeply influenced by local folklore and stories. I wanted to bring these stories to a global audience through the powerful medium of cinema."
Tiwary also spoke about the unique appeal of the film, stating, "A story like Blessed Be The Evil is truly one-of-a-kind. It's a chilling narrative filled with suspense and drama, offering great potential for both international streaming and theatrical markets."
Kangana Ranaut, known for her dynamic roles in Bollywood, brings immense star power to the film. With four National Film Awards and four Filmfare Awards to her name, she is also an accomplished filmmaker and a Member of Parliament in India. Her recent directorial debut, ‘Emergency’, where she portrayed Prime Minister Indira Gandhi, had a global theatrical release earlier this year.
Tyler Posey, famous for his role in ‘Teen Wolf’, brings his experience in the horror genre, having appeared in films like ‘Truth or Dare’. Scarlett Rose Stallone, the daughter of Hollywood icons Sylvester Stallone and Jennifer Flavin, has previously appeared in ‘Reach Me’ and starred alongside Nicolas Cage in The ‘Gunslingers’.
